redis 6个节点(3主3从),始终一个节点不能启动

redis 6个节点(3主3从),始终一个节点不能启动_第1张图片
redis节点,始终有一个节点不能启动起来

1.修改了配置文件 protected-mode no,重启

修改了配置文件 protected-mode no,重启redis问题依然存在

2、查看/var/log/message的redis日志

Aug 21 07:40:33 redisMaster kernel: Out of memory: Kill process 31814 (redis-server) score 193 or sacrifice child
Aug 21 07:40:33 redisMaster kernel: Killed process 31814 (redis-server) total-vm:1675000kB, anon-rss:1537180kB, file-rss:0kB, shmem-rss:0kB

3、查看机器内存


              total        used        free      shared  buff/cache   available
Mem:           7552        7202         131           0         217         119

说明机器内存没有了,所以会杀死节点

4、升配置机器,重启redis,节点能够启动成功

cd /data/cluster/7001  && redis-server redis.conf
cd /data/cluster/7002  && redis-server redis.conf
cd /data/cluster/7003  && redis-server redis.conf
cd /data/cluster/7004  && redis-server redis.conf
cd /data/cluster/7005  && redis-server redis.conf
cd /data/cluster/7006  && redis-server redis.conf

你可能感兴趣的:(redis,数据库,缓存)